Our College to Career initiative prioritizes equipping you with essential skills, savvy and connections that will give you a competitive edge in today’s ever-evolving job market. College to Career encompasses dozens of programs and tools that weave professional preparedness into every element of your college journey.
Visit University Career Services (UCS) for help exploring majors and finding, applying and preparing for professional opportunities. UCS also offers resume reviews and mock interviews and hosts on-campus job fairs and events.
Create a free Steppingblocks account to explore national employment data and employment data specific to Georgia State alumni. You’ll get postgraduate insights, too. Easy to tap into, it’s like a digital career counselor at your fingertips.
Search Handshake, our free online board that connects you with 5,000+ employers hiring for full-time, part-time, internship and co-op positions. You’ll be the first to know about jobs as they’re posted, which gives you an edge in applying.
Call on Optimal Resume to craft an impressive resume and cover letters. You can also view short training videos on how to showcase to employers why you’re the best candidate for the job. And use the digital platform Portfolium to demonstrate your work and experiences to companies in a way that goes beyond the typical resume.
Visit the Iris Booth at Student Center West to take a free professional headshot for your resume and stop by the Career Closet to borrow an array of professional attire for interviews and nail the looking-the-part part.

Visit our Program Explorer page to browse majors by academic areas of interest. We call those areas of interest meta-majors, and they include STEM (science, technology, engineering and math), business, arts and humanities, health, education, policy and social science, and exploratory.
